Essex and Suffolk Elective Orthopaedic Centre (ESEOC), situated in the Dame Clare Marx Building, specializes in elective Orthopaedic surgery and Orthopaedic day cases. With eight laminar flow theatres, three wards, recovery facilities, and comprehensive support services, ESEOC aims to become one of the largest centres of its kind in Europe, committed to delivering high-volume, low-complexity cases locally. We are looking for a physiotherapist to join the new service and work as part of our Orthopaedic physiotherapy team. Main duties of the job
To gain experience and develop skills and knowledge in Orthopaedic physiotherapy within the acute setting. Understanding and contributing to the orthopaedic physiotherapy pathways. To manage own caseload of patients, seeking advice and problem-solving from senior staff when required. To collaborate with the MDT in ESEOC to contribute to the care of elective patients.
